Why the Right Wood Matters for Pulled Pork

Pulled pork, typically smoked from pork shoulder or pork butt, requires slow cooking at low temperatures. The smoking wood’s flavor should complement the pork's natural sweetness without overpowering it. Woods that burn too hot or impart harsh, bitter smoke can ruin the subtle pork flavors. The best smoking woods add smoky sweetness, mild spice, and sometimes a fruity aroma that enhances the meat’s juiciness and bark formation.


Top 10 Smoking Woods for Pulled Pork

01. Hickory

Hickory is often considered the quintessential smoking wood for pork. It provides a strong, smoky flavor with sweet bacon-like notes that penetrate deep into the meat. It’s ideal for those who prefer traditional, bold BBQ flavors. Hickory works well alone or blended with fruitwoods for balance. Available in chips or chunks on Amazon, it's a versatile staple for pulled pork smokers.


02. Apple

Apple wood is known for its mild, sweet, and fruity smoke. It's perfect for pulled pork, imparting a subtle aroma that doesn’t overpower the meat. Apple wood smoke creates a beautiful golden crust and adds a delicate sweetness, making it a favorite among barbecue enthusiasts. It’s especially good for longer smokes where a gentle smoke is preferred.


03. Cherry

Cherry wood gives a mild, sweet smoke with a pleasant fruity undertone and also helps to give the pork a rich reddish color. It’s excellent for adding depth and a subtle sweetness to pulled pork. This wood pairs well with oak or hickory and is widely available with positive reviews on Amazon.


04. Oak

Oak is a classic hardwood that provides a medium to strong smoke flavor without being overpowering. It burns evenly and is a great base wood to mix with fruitwoods like apple or cherry. Oak’s robust flavor complements pork well, producing a well-balanced taste and a beautiful bark on the meat.

05. Pecan

Pecan wood offers a unique savory flavor reminiscent of bacon, making it a luxurious choice for pulled pork smoking. It combines sweet and nutty nuances that enhance the pork’s flavor complexity. Pecan is easier to work with than some heavier woods, and its rich taste is highly regarded.


06. Maple

Maple adds a slightly sweet and subtle flavor that melds wonderfully with pork. It helps render the fat and forms a golden crust, enriching the overall eating experience. Maple wood is great for those who want a softer smoke impact without overwhelming the natural pork taste.


07. Peach

Peach wood provides a floral and delicate smoke with mild citrus notes, suitable for lighter smoke flavors. It is excellent for more delicate pork cuts or when you want a nuanced smoke without acidity. Peach wood is less common but cherished by those who like to experiment.


08. Mulberry

Mulberry smoke is mild and slightly sweet with tangy blackberry notes. It’s similar to apple wood but offers a unique flavor twist that pairs excellently with pork. It infuses a subtle fruity essence that enhances the meat’s sweetness.


09. Pear

Pear wood delivers a subtle, sweet, and fruity smoke, similar to apple but generally sweeter. It won’t overpower pork and adds just a light hint of pear flavor, perfect for nuanced smoked pulled pork preparations.

10. Walnut

Walnut is a bold choice with an intense, somewhat bitter smoke that balances pork’s natural sweetness exceptionally well. It produces a complex, deep smoky flavor but should be used sparingly or mixed with milder woods to avoid bitterness.


Tips for Using Smoking Wood

  • Mix your woods: Combining a hardwood like oak or hickory with a fruitwood like apple or cherry can create the best flavor harmony.

  • Use quality wood: Always choose clean, untreated smoking wood chunks or chips from reputable sources like Amazon to avoid chemicals.

  • Soak chips if using: Soaking wood chips for 30 minutes before adding to your smoker helps prolong the smoke duration without burning too fast.

  • Control your smoke: Too much smoke can taste bitter. Aim for thin blue smoke rather than billowing white clouds.
